Transaction 93550255ca0d26be7010cd676d20c39b49561ac324c0188d98509bbd6d26831c
1 Input
1 Output
-
93550255ca0d26be7010cd676d20c39b49561ac324c0188d98509bbd6d26831c:0
- value
- 308464
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b960df75fa9cb8cf37bea8fc453afa17d17b339 OP_EQUAL
- address
- 34CsvhMGY5xB2eNwEhRpUUXtN1tgxm7iky